The Heart of the Beast: Understanding the Turbo V6 Engine
Alright guys, let's get down to the nitty-gritty of what makes a Turbo V6 car such a beast on the road. At its core, we have the V6 engine. Now, V6 stands for 'Vee six', meaning it has six cylinders arranged in a 'V' shape. This configuration offers a great balance – it's more powerful and smoother than a typical inline-4, but generally more compact and fuel-efficient than a V8. Think of it as the sweet spot for performance and practicality. But here's where things get really exciting: the turbocharger. A turbocharger is essentially an air pump powered by your car's exhaust gases. As exhaust fumes leave the engine, they spin a turbine. This turbine is connected to another turbine (a compressor), which sucks in fresh, cool air and forces it into the engine's cylinders under pressure. More air means you can burn more fuel, and burning more fuel means a massive increase in power! So, when you combine the inherent balance and smoothness of a V6 with the power-boosting magic of a turbo, you get an engine that's both potent and surprisingly refined. This 'forced induction' allows smaller displacement engines to produce power comparable to larger naturally aspirated engines, all while maintaining better fuel economy. It’s a win-win, really. Why are Turbo V6 Cars So Popular?
So, what's the deal with all the hype around Turbo V6 cars? Why are they everywhere, from your neighbor's daily driver to the racetrack? Well, guys, it boils down to a few key things that just make sense for a lot of drivers. First off, performance. We've already touched on how a turbocharger gives a V6 engine a serious power boost. This means you get that exhilarating acceleration and overtaking power without needing a huge, gas-guzzling V8. It’s like having your cake and eating it too! You get the thrills, but you don't necessarily pay as much at the pump. Secondly, efficiency. Modern turbo V6 engines are incredibly clever. By using turbocharging, manufacturers can use smaller, lighter V6 engines that produce the power of older, larger V8s, but sip fuel more like a V6. This is a huge win in today's world, where fuel prices can be wild and environmental concerns are top of mind. You get impressive horsepower figures while still managing respectable miles per gallon. Thirdly, driving dynamics. A V6 engine is generally lighter and more compact than a V8. This means manufacturers can place it further back in the chassis, leading to better weight distribution. Better weight distribution translates to sharper handling, more predictable cornering, and a more balanced feel when you're driving. When you combine this with the instant torque delivered by the turbo, you get a car that feels nimble, responsive, and downright fun to drive. It’s that perfect blend of a planted feel and the ability to quickly surge forward when needed. Fourth, versatility. Turbo V6s aren't just for sports cars. You'll find them in luxury sedans, performance SUVs, and even some trucks. This versatility means that a wide range of consumers can enjoy the benefits of this engine technology, whether they need a family hauler with some pep or a weekend warrior that can still handle the daily commute. The engineers have really nailed the tuning to provide a broad powerband, making them suitable for both spirited driving and relaxed cruising. The ability to deliver strong low-end torque for city driving and then unleash impressive horsepower at higher RPMs for highway merging or spirited canyon carving makes the turbo V6 an incredibly adaptable powerplant. The Future of Turbo V6 Cars
So, what's next for the amazing Turbo V6 cars? It's an exciting time, guys, because even with the rise of electric vehicles, the turbo V6 isn't fading away anytime soon. In fact, engineers are constantly finding new ways to make these engines even better. One of the biggest trends is hybridization. We're seeing more and more turbo V6 engines paired with electric motors. This combination can offer incredible power – think supercar levels of acceleration – while also improving fuel efficiency and reducing emissions. The electric motor can provide instant torque to fill in any gaps in the turbo's power delivery, making the acceleration feel even smoother and more seamless. It's the best of both worlds: the visceral thrill of a combustion engine combined with the instant grunt and efficiency of electric power. Another area of massive innovation is in materials and technology. We're seeing advancements in turbocharger design, like variable geometry turbos (VGTs) and twin-scroll turbos, which spool up faster and provide more consistent boost across the rev range. New lightweight alloys and advanced manufacturing techniques are making engines lighter and more robust, allowing them to handle higher power outputs reliably. Emissions regulations are also a huge driving force. While some might think this spells the end for powerful engines, it's actually pushing innovation. Manufacturers are developing sophisticated exhaust after-treatment systems and advanced engine management software to ensure turbo V6s meet ever-stricter environmental standards without sacrificing performance.
